From f172dae4b909b93a9a2c16f9ae89c661c0720830 Mon Sep 17 00:00:00 2001 From: Phil Blundell Date: Tue, 17 Aug 2004 20:43:20 +0000 Subject: Merge bk://openembedded@openembedded.bkbits.net/packages into stealth.(none):/home/pb/oe/oe-packages 2004/08/17 21:43:01+01:00 (none)!pb also handle 'include' lines in locale defs BKrev: 41226de8W0uNfLN9PIIZm1VvYfJ4CA --- glibc/glibc-package.oeclass | 6 ++---- glibc/glibc_2.3.2+cvs20040726.oe | 2 +- 2 files changed, 3 insertions(+), 5 deletions(-) diff --git a/glibc/glibc-package.oeclass b/glibc/glibc-package.oeclass index ff484f9189..adfe05c87e 100644 --- a/glibc/glibc-package.oeclass +++ b/glibc/glibc-package.oeclass @@ -71,8 +71,9 @@ python package_do_split_gconvs () { deps = [] f = open(fn, "r") c_re = re.compile('^copy "(.*)"') + i_re = re.compile('^include "(\w+)".*') for l in f.readlines(): - m = c_re.match(l) + m = c_re.match(l) or i_re.match(l) if m: dp = legitimize_package_name('glibc-localedata-%s' % m.group(1)) if not dp in deps: @@ -82,9 +83,6 @@ python package_do_split_gconvs () { oe.data.setVar('RDEPENDS_%s' % pkg, " ".join(deps), d) do_split_packages(d, locales_dir, file_regex='(.*)', output_pattern='glibc-localedata-%s', description='locale definition for %s', hook=calc_locale_deps) - # clobber unwanted self-dependency - oe.data.setVar('RDEPENDS_glibc-localedata-i18n', '', d) - oe.data.setVar('PACKAGES', oe.data.getVar('PACKAGES', d) + ' glibc-gconv', d) f = open(os.path.join(oe.data.getVar('WORKDIR', d, 1), "SUPPORTED"), "r") diff --git a/glibc/glibc_2.3.2+cvs20040726.oe b/glibc/glibc_2.3.2+cvs20040726.oe index a04e20ee63..b1f446d0ce 100644 --- a/glibc/glibc_2.3.2+cvs20040726.oe +++ b/glibc/glibc_2.3.2+cvs20040726.oe @@ -1,5 +1,5 @@ FILESDIR = "${@os.path.dirname(oe.data.getVar('FILE',d,1))}/glibc-cvs" -PR = "r6" +PR = "r8" DESCRIPTION = "GNU C Library" LICENSE = "LGPL" SECTION = "libs" -- cgit v1.2.3